SELFPHP: Version 5.8.2 Befehlsreferenz - Tutorial – Kochbuch – Forum für PHP Einsteiger und professionelle Entwickler

SELFPHP


Professional CronJob-Service

Suche



CronJob-Service    
bei SELFPHP mit ...



 + minütlichen Aufrufen
 + eigenem Crontab Eintrag
 + unbegrenzten CronJobs
 + Statistiken
 + Beispielaufrufen
 + Control-Bereich

Führen Sie mit den CronJobs von SELFPHP zeitgesteuert Programme auf Ihrem Server aus. Weitere Infos



:: Buchempfehlung ::

Handbuch der Java-Programmierung

Handbuch der Java-Programmierung zur Buchempfehlung
 

:: Anbieterverzeichnis ::

Globale Branchen

Informieren Sie sich über ausgewählte Unternehmen im Anbieterverzeichnis von SELFPHP  

 

:: Newsletter ::

Abonnieren Sie hier den kostenlosen SELFPHP Newsletter!

Vorname: 
Name:
E-Mail:
 
 

Zurück   PHP Forum > SELFPHP > PHP für Fortgeschrittene und Experten
Hilfe Community Kalender Heutige Beiträge Suchen

PHP für Fortgeschrittene und Experten Fortgeschrittene und Experten können hier über ihre Probleme und Bedenken talken

Antwort
 
Themen-Optionen Ansicht
  #1  
Alt 18.09.2002, 13:40:52
:) das ich (: :) das ich (: ist offline
Anfänger
 
Registriert seit: Sep 2002
Beiträge: 4
Teilstring kopieren

Hi, ich hab ein Problem.

Ich hab in meiner Datenbank ein Feld wo ein String drin gespeichert wird (vom User) nun soll dieser einen Code eingeben können in der art:

[test:12323] oder [test]123[/test]

jetzt brauch ich eine funktion die mir den Zahlencode (immer Zahlen - keine Buchstaben) herausfiltert und in einer Variablen speichert.

Ich hab leider nur eine Funktion gefunden wo ich die länge angeben muss, aber dass kann ich nicht, da die Länge immer unterschiedlich ist.

Ich such also so was wie eine Function der ich den Startstring und den Endstring übergeben kann und der sucht mir alles was dazwischen ist raus.

Ich hoffe das ist verständlich.....

MFG ich
__________________
äh,... wie PHP??? mmm
Mit Zitat antworten
  #2  
Alt 18.09.2002, 14:38:41
MiH MiH ist offline
Member
 
Registriert seit: Aug 2002
Beiträge: 775
also das ist dein string in der db:
123456888998896655 <- dann steht das ja in einer spalte.
ausgabe dann eben so:
"[test]".$row['str']."[/test]";
Mit Zitat antworten
  #3  
Alt 18.09.2002, 15:56:12
:) das ich (: :) das ich (: ist offline
Anfänger
 
Registriert seit: Sep 2002
Beiträge: 4
neee, andersrum

Der string ist z.B.

"Hallo, wie geht's ich hab da was [test:123213] wie findest Du das?"

und aus dem ganzen Teil will ich jetzt das 123213 raus haben und als Variable speichern. (das ganze [test:123213] soll nachher aus dem String entfernt werden und dafür soll da eine Tabelle eingefügt werden (das ist alles kein Problem) aber um die Tabelle zu erstellen brauch ich eben diesen Zahlencode weil ich da noch mit einer anderen Datenbank verbinden muss und alle Felder rausholen die in der Zeile mit der id 123213 stehen.
__________________
äh,... wie PHP??? mmm
Mit Zitat antworten
  #4  
Alt 18.09.2002, 17:03:19
Progman Progman ist offline
Member
 
Registriert seit: Apr 2002
Beiträge: 821
Progman eine Nachricht über ICQ schicken
regex

http://de.php.net/pcre

z.b.
if(preg_match(=[test](d+)[/test]=i',$string,$matches))
{
echo("passt");
print_r($matches);
}
else
{
echo("kein solcher tag drin");
}
Mit Zitat antworten
  #5  
Alt 18.09.2002, 17:19:43
:) das ich (: :) das ich (: ist offline
Anfänger
 
Registriert seit: Sep 2002
Beiträge: 4
mmm das würde bedeuten dass ich alle vorkommenden Codes in einem Array hab, oder?

Wenn ich jetzt aber jeweils an der Stelle wo das vorher stand das neue haben will dann geht das nicht, oder???

mmm na ja... ist aber besser als nix, danke :) dann werd ich mich mal ransetzen und das bei mir einbauen......
__________________
äh,... wie PHP??? mmm
Mit Zitat antworten
Antwort


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
 

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ind aus.
[IMG] Code ist aus.
HTML-Code ist aus.

Gehe zu


Alle Zeitangaben in WEZ +2. Es ist jetzt 08:17:27 Uhr.


Powered by vBulletin® Version 3.8.3 (Deutsch)
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.


© 2001-2024 E-Mail SELFPHP OHG, info@selfphp.deImpressumKontakt